Trotting stalwart Our Overanova appears on-track to defend his DJ Alexander Memorial Trot Final this summer after recording a fourth win in five starts at Redcliffe on Saturday. 

The rising nine-year-old notched career win 51 despite spotting his rivals 50m from the standing-start. 

But he showed why he was crowned Queensland Trotter of the Year when rounding up stablemates Southern Alps and Mister Gunsen to win by 3.5m. 

Our Overanova won a similar race at Albion Park almost one year ago to the day, before his runs were spaced leading into the DJ heats and final. 

It was a rare Saturday night at Redcliffe with Dixon only landing the one winner. 

Kylie Rasmussen and visiting horseman Craig Cross, who has his sights set on the Queensland Summer Carnival, both snared doubles. 

Adam Sanderson continued his winning form following a successful Australian Driving Championship last week, steering his in-form mare Novena Rose to a 10th career win in the mares qualifying pace.
